A Janitor (Japanese: せいそういん Cleaner) is a type of Trainer class introduced in Generation V. They are old men dressed in green janitor outfits that hold mops. They could be considered a male counterpart of Maids.

Despite being cleaners, they tend to use Pokémon that represent filth, such as Trubbish and Koffing, as well as Pokémon that love to clean, such as Minccino. They mainly use Poison-type Pokémon. This may mean that they capture filthy Pokémon to remove them from the area. In the Battle Subway, they specialize in Pokémon sets meant for Double Battles, even in the Single Trains.

In the manga

In the Pokémon Adventures manga

Black and White meet Janitor Geoff on the Skyarrow Bridge after being attacked by a mysterious Pokémon on their way to Castelia City. He berates the two for getting the bridge dirty and challenges Black to a battle. After losing, Geoff reveals that he is actually the president of the Battle Company, and that the Pokémon that had attacked them was the legendary Virizion.

Geoff later appears at the Pokémon League alongside several other Trainers to help battle Team Plasma.

Trivia

  • Janitor Geoff in Pokémon Black and White gives an Exp. Share as a reward for being defeated in addition to the reward money. He says that as the president of the Battle Company, it is his duty. He also says he likes observing his employees while disguised.
  • The Janitor Trainer class is one of two classes who give out different amounts of monetary awards, with the other being the Clerk ♂ class. However, this is due to one Janitor being a company president in disguise, and the rest of the class are real janitors, obviously creating a fiscal mismatch between the two. On the other hand, the Clerk ♂ class has their socio-economic status divided by their sprites.
